Robert “Drew” Bulba

NORRIDGEWOCK – Our beloved son, father, brother, and friend, Robert “Drew” Bulba, 35, of Norridgewock passed away on Sept. 2, 2023.

Drew was born on March 29, 1988, to John and Renee Bulba in Hartford, Conn. Drew attended Norridgewock Elementary School and graduated from Skowhegan Area High School in 2006.

Drew was well known as being generous, friendly, and charismatic. His family and many friends would describe him as easy-going, kind, and always brightening a room with his presence; he had a genuinely good and big heart.

From a young age, Drew had a variety of hobbies and a very strong work ethic. As a little boy, he could often be seen flying past his dad on a ski mountain (alternating between skis and a snowboard), swinging a hammer on a construction site while learning the tricks of the trade, or in the kitchen making an egg omelet for his grandparents.

Drew was also a stellar first-baseman, and many summers during his childhood were spent on baseball fields with his mom cheering from the bleachers. At the age of 13, Drew began working at Cayford Orchards in Skowhegan, and his time and relationship with owners Heather and Jason spanned over 20 years – they were considered family.

In 2006, Drew met Brittany Guerette, and after 10 years together, they welcomed their son, Joseph “Jamyson” Bulba into this world – naming him after Drew’s late grandfather, “Pop,” for whom Drew had a very special bond and deep connection. Drew imparted his sense of adventure and excitement for life to his son, Jamyson – his “little buddy.” Drew introduced him to snowboarding, dirt biking, concerts, fishing, cooking, kayaking, disc golf, and to the world of apple picking. Jamyson was the absolute light of Drew’s life, and his open heart, kind nature, and love and care for others carries on within his son.

Drew was predeceased by his grandfather, Joseph Bulba.

He is survived by a long list of people who loved and adored him, including, but not limited to his 7-year-old son, Jamyson; father, John Bulba (Bob) of Norridgewock; mother, Renee Steadman of Bowdinham; siblings Dana Bulba (Thomas) of Lakewood, Colo., Rachael Bulba (Nick) of Skowhegan, and Sean O’Keefe (Brittany) of Eldorado Hills, Calif.; grandmother, Lorraine Bulba of Orlando, Fla.; aunts, uncles; and cousins Tammy, Micki, Glenn, Olivia (Stephen), Alex, and Eric (Cherie); and a long, long list of friends.

The heartache Drew’s family is experiencing is beyond words, and they appreciate all the love and support our friends, family, and community have provided during this time.

Drew’s family will be holding a Celebration of Life in the spring will welcome everyone who knew and loved Drew with open arms; more information will be forthcoming.

In lieu of flowers, please consider contributing to a fund for his son, Joseph Jamyson Bulba, at New Dimensions Federal Credit Union in Skowhegan
